How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Summerton?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Summerton Studio Apartments | $1,673 | $1,327 | $2,599 |
| Summerton 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,580 | $755 | $2,289 |
| Summerton 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,833 | $748 | $3,099 |
| Summerton 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,068 | $925 | $2,937 |
| Summerton 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,119 | $1,010 | $2,435 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Summerton
How much are Studio apartments in Summerton?
There are currently 8 Studio Apartments in Summerton with rent ranges from $1,327 to $2,599 with an average price of $1,673.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Summerton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Summerton ranges from $755 to $2,289 with an average monthly rent of $1,580.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Summerton c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Summerton range from $748 to $3,099.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,833.
How expensive are Summerton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 46 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Summerton on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$925 to $2,937 - averaging $2,068 for the location.
